
Bob Reeves patented his sleeve system in 1974 (US
Patent 3,808,935). This system allows the trumpet
player to optimize his/her gap for sound, pitch, and
playability or to use the same mouthpiece in
different horns that require a different gap.
Once a mouthpiece has been converted for our sleeve
system, different sleeves can be used in order to
"dial in" the correct gap. Our sleeves
vary in diameter in small, but significant,
increments thus increasing or decreasing the gap.
They are available in
half sizes from #1 through #7 (largest gap is #1,
smallest is #7).
The change in gap from one sleeve size to the next
is .0625" (1/16 inch). Sleeves are available in
half sizes allowing for gap adjustments of .0313
(1/32 inch). |
